The most prominent critic in this regard was ingrid sichy who, in an article titled good intentions in the new yorker magazine, claimed, beautifying human tragedy results in pictures that ultimately reinforce our passivity towards the experience they reveal. She was the editorinchief of artforum from 1980 to 1988, the editorinchief of interview magazine from 1989 to 2008, a consulting editor at the new yorker from 1988 to 1996, and a contributing editor to vanity fair from 1997 to 2015. Ingrid sischy was a south africanborn american writer and art critic who focused on art, photography, and fashion.
